Transaction d5be5004fd16bd57c07061406c9a163f2228c36f0339f1824f26778919a15c81

1 Input
2 Outputs
  • d5be5004fd16bd57c07061406c9a163f2228c36f0339f1824f26778919a15c81:0
  • value  21666349
    address  39beMqpW5vVbUTbQqX4WFJkk8BMR3rRkdj
  • d5be5004fd16bd57c07061406c9a163f2228c36f0339f1824f26778919a15c81:1
  • value  1047686
    address  3L27rQ4YSdUriP8KqCgmXNXG5nmeMMhSqw